數據庫備份類型一般有完全備份、事務日志備份、差異備份和文件備份。
1. 完全備份:備份整個數據庫,包含用戶表、系統表、索引、視圖和存儲過程等所有數據庫對象,需要花費更多的時間和空間,一般推薦一周做一次完全備份。
2. 事務日志備份:一個單獨的文件,記錄數據庫的改變,備份的時候只需要復制自上次備份以來對數據庫所做的改變,所以只需要很少的時間,為了使數據庫具有魯棒性,推薦每小時甚至更頻繁的備份事務日志。
3. 差異備份:也叫增量備份,只備份數據庫一部分的另一種方法,它不使用事務日志,相反,它使用整個數據庫的一種新映象,它比最初的完全備份小,因為它只包含自上次完全備份以來所改變的數據庫,其優點是存儲和恢復速度快,推薦每天做一次差異備份。
4. 文件備份:如果這個數據庫非常大,并且一個晚上也不能將它備份完,那么可以使用文件備份每晚備份數據庫的一部分。
數據庫備份類型

數據庫備份是數據存儲和恢復的重要環節,是保證數據安全性和完整性的重要手段。根據不同的備份需求和策略,有多種不同的數據庫備份類型,以下將分別介紹七種常見的數據庫備份類型。
1. 完全備份
完全備份是數據庫備份中最基礎和最簡單的備份方式,它將整個數據庫文件進行備份,包括所有的數據、對象和元數據。這種備份方式優點是簡單易用,備份和恢復速度快,適合小型數據庫。但是,完全備份需要占用大量的備份空間,對于大型數據庫來說可能會非常耗時且占用大量存儲資源。
2. 差異備份
差異備份是根據完全備份來生成的,它備份自上次完全備份之后發生變化的數據庫部分。差異備份可以減少備份時間和存儲空間的使用量,適合大型數據庫。但是,恢復過程比完全備份要復雜,需要先恢復完全備份,再恢復差異備份。
3. 增量備份
增量備份是只備份自上次完全或差異備份之后發生變化的數據庫部分。這種備份方式可以進一步減少備份時間和存儲空間的使用量,但恢復過程需要先恢復完全備份,再恢復增量備份,比差異備份更加復雜。
4. 事務日志備份
事務日志備份是備份數據庫操作的事務日志,記錄了數據庫的增刪改操作。這種備份方式可以保證數據的完整性和一致性,但需要較大的存儲空間和備份時間。事務日志備份可以單獨使用,也可以與完全備份或差異備份結合使用。
5. 文件/頁備份
文件/頁備份是針對數據庫文件或頁的備份方式。它可以將數據庫文件或頁復制到另一個位置,以防止文件或頁損壞或丟失。這種備份方式適用于大型數據庫,可以減少備份時間和存儲空間的使用量。但是,恢復過程需要逐個恢復文件或頁,比完全備份和差異備份更加耗時。
6. 文件物理備份
文件物理備份是針對數據庫文件的物理副本的備份方式。它可以將整個數據庫文件復制到另一個位置,并記錄每個文件的物理位置和大小等信息。這種備份方式適用于大型數據庫,可以減少備份時間和存儲空間的使用量。但是,恢復過程需要逐個恢復文件并重新組織數據結構,比完全備份和差異備份更加耗時。
7. 邏輯備份
邏輯備份是通過讀取數據庫中的數據并將其轉換為可讀格式進行備份的方式。邏輯備份可以包括整個數據庫、部分表或特定數據集等。這種備份方式適用于大型數據庫和復雜的數據庫結構,可以減少備份時間和存儲空間的使用量。但是,恢復過程需要將備份數據轉換為可寫格式并重新導入到數據庫中,比完全備份和差異備份更加耗時。
以上七種數據庫備份類型各有優缺點,應根據具體的應用場景和需求選擇合適的備份方式。同時,為了確保數據的安全性和完整性,應定期進行數據庫備份并妥善保管備份數據。
下一篇:u盤修復命令chkdsk